Marilyn Manson Lists Los Angeles Home for a Slim Profit
A Zen Retreat in the Making
Marilyn Manson has listed his home in Glendale, California for $2.27 million. Should the controversial goth-rock musician find a buyer for the dwelling — which boasts skyline vistas, mountain views, and a wraparound redwood deck — he’ll turn a profit of just $75,000. Realtor.com first reported on the listing.
A Home Fit for a Rockstar
The 56-year-old shock-rock singer has parting with his Glendale home in Los Angeles County. The listing describes the 0.33-acre property as “rich with wild flowers, lemon dress, and aged oak trees.” Interior photos of the 2,107-square-foot home are conspicuously free of Manson’s signature style — think skulls and black candles. Instead, its brightly lit rooms, white-washed walls, and wraparound redwood deck appear well-suited for a Crate and Barrel catalog.
Features and Amenities
The living room features a floor-to-ceiling lava rock fireplace, and the open-concept downstairs includes a chef’s kitchen. The home includes four bedrooms and three bathrooms, as well as an additional accessory dwelling unit that currently functions as a recording studio. Listing photos also show an apparent yoga studio with blacked-out windows.
A Turbulent Past
Manson purchased the property in May 2022 for $2.2 million, two months after suing his ex, actress Evan Rachel Wood, for defamation. Wood accused Manson in 2021 of sexually and physically abusing her, in a statement shared with Vanity Fair and posted to her Instagram profile. Manson has denied the allegations made against him by multiple women.
A Settlement and a New Beginning
The listing comes four months after Manson dropped the defamation suit and paid Wood’s $327,000 legal fees in a settlement. Manson previously sold his Spanish-style Los Angeles mansion for $1.83 million in 2021, the same year it was raided by the Special Victims Units of the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Office in connection to allegations of sexual abuse by several women. California prosecutors dropped their years-long investigation earlier this year, saying in a statement that the allegations exceeded the statute of limitations, and they could not “prove charges of sexual assault beyond a reasonable doubt.”
What’s Next for Marilyn Manson?
Manson recently announced the spring kickoff of his first American tour since 2019. The controversy surrounding his past has not deterred the rocker, who seems to be moving forward with his music and public appearances.
